E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
feign远程调用
SpringBoot启动流程
定义启动类@Enable
Feign
Clients@EnableDiscoveryClient@EnableTransactionManagement@SpringBootApplicationpublicclassCDAApplicationextendsSpringBootServletInitializer
weixin_44877172
·
2024-01-23 13:19
sprinboot
java
spring
boot
后端
java
使用RestTemplate
远程调用
及基于RestTemplate的服务降级(hystrix)
表结构及测试数据DROPTABLEIFEXISTS`product`;CREATETABLE`product`(`productId`bigint(20)NOTNULLAUTO_INCREMENT,`productName`varchar(50)DEFAULTNULL,`productDesc`varchar(50)DEFAULTNULL,PRIMARYKEY(`productId`))ENGIN
weixin_44877172
·
2024-01-23 13:47
springcloud
java
java
spring
cloud
RPC教程 4.超时处理机制
纵观整个
远程调用
的过程,需要客户端处理超时的地方有:与服务端建立连接,导致的超时发送请求到服
确实可以
·
2024-01-23 11:33
#
Go实现rpc
rpc
网络
golang
RPC和HTTP,它们之间到底啥关系
为什么使用HTTP/2SpringCloud默认是微服务通过RestfulAPI来进行互相调用各自微服务的方法,同时也支持集成第三方RPC框架(这里的说的RPC是特指在一个应用中调用另一个应用的接口而实现的
远程调用
greedy-hat
·
2024-01-23 11:31
rpc
http
网络协议
Sentinel降级操作
1.通过对
feign
调用的降级如果访问失败,则返回另外的信息正常的
feign
调用@
Feign
Client(value="gulimall-seckill",fallback=Seckill
Feign
ServiceFallback.class
wmd13164306712
·
2024-01-23 11:56
sentinel
java
开发语言
JSON-RPC笔记
json-rpc是一种非常轻量级的跨语言
远程调用
协议,使用简单,仅需几十行代码,即可实现一个
远程调用
的客户端,方便语言扩展客户端的实现。
boss-dog
·
2024-01-23 10:50
网络通信编程
json
rpc
笔记
Open
Feign
Open
Feign
Open
Feign
是一个声明式的Web服务客户端,它使得编写HTTP客户端变得更简单。使用
Feign
,只需要创建一个接口并在接口上添加注解即可完成对远程服务的定义和调用。
C道万古如长夜,V来!
·
2024-01-23 09:47
架构
微服务
java
2024-01-17(SpringCloud)
1.使用open
Feign
的itemClient接口去做
远程调用
其他微服务中的接口。但我们直接使用了itemClient接口,而不是该接口的实现类,说明我们是使用该接口的代理对象帮我们做
远程调用
的。
陈xr
·
2024-01-23 09:04
随记日志
spring
cloud
spring
后端
负载均衡-
Feign
1.1.简介
feign
是声明式的webservice客户端,它让微服务之间的调用变得更简单了,类似controller调用service。
Tony666688888
·
2024-01-23 09:17
负载均衡
运维
RPC框架简介
RPC的目的就是让构建分布式计算(应用)更加简单,在提供强大的调用
远程调用
的同时不失去简单的本地调用的语义简洁性RPC整体架构服务端启动时首先将自己的服务节点信息注册到注册中心,客户端调用远程方法时会订阅注册中心中的可用服务节点信息
努力学习的小飞侠
·
2024-01-22 23:01
分布式
rpc
php
qt
Spring Cloud
Feign
记录错误日志
1.pom.xmlorg.springframework.cloudspring-cloud-starter-
feign
2.配置文件#开启
feign
feign
.hystrix.enabled=true#
涛哥是个大帅比
·
2024-01-22 21:37
Spring
feign
fallback
fallbackFactory
spring自定义RequestMappingHandlerMapping
importjakarta.servlet.ServletException;importjakarta.servlet.http.HttpServletRequest;importorg.springframework.cloud.open
feign
.
Feign
Client
qq_41597666
·
2024-01-22 20:58
spring
java
后端
Java面试题50道
Spring事务传播行为有几种6.Spring是怎么解决循环依赖的7.SpringBoot自动配置原理8.SpringBoot配置文件类型以及加载顺序9.SpringCloud的常用组件有哪些10.说一说
Feign
你小汁完了
·
2024-01-22 15:11
面试题
java
面试
idea远程服务调试
然后设置
远程调用
的ip和port,并且注意要选择JDK版本,然后在下面选择nomodule,最后应用即可。2.配置远程的tomcat在vibin/cata
Luke Ewin
·
2024-01-22 13:37
项目开发
intellij-idea
java
ide
Feign
Client调用报错405请求方法错误
文章目录背景原因
Feign
Client调用流程简化后主要流程背景
Feign
Client和GetMapping组合报错405请求方法错误在编写代码的时候,遇到一个情况,在使用
Feign
Client调用服务
凌麟柒
·
2024-01-22 12:23
源码分析
SpringCloud
分布式
java
springCloud的ribbon和
feign
首先得有一个注册中心,然后各种服务注册进去,然后利用ribbon或者
feign
去调用。ribbon是直接用地址拼接,然后调用。
菜汪在路上
·
2024-01-22 12:22
springCloud
spring
cloud
ribbon
java
RMI
远程调用
温故而知新可以为师矣1.远程接口packagecom.example.rmi;importjava.rmi.Remote;importjava.rmi.RemoteException;publicinterfaceIServiceextendsRemote{StringsayHello()throwsRemoteException;StringsayHello(Stringname)throwsR
离别刀
·
2024-01-22 12:55
服务调用Ribbon,LoadBalance,
Feign
服务调用Ribbon、FeginRibbon实现负载均衡的原理1:LoadBalancerAutoConfiguration这个类,这个类主要做的就是把LoadBalancer拦截器封装到RestTemplte拦截器集合里面去。2:然后在代码里面调用restTemplate.getForObject或者其他方法的时候,就会调用到这个拦截器。3:在LoadBalancer拦截器类中,就会调用inte
一路向北·重庆分伦
·
2024-01-22 10:54
springCloud各组件
ribbon
spring
cloud
后端
Spring Cloud 自定义负载均衡的一些问题
首先需要有多个微服务提供者,并且均注册到nacos中心,注册名称一致,然后通过open
feign
调用则会默认开启轮询负载均衡策略。这里先简单记录下open
feign
配置。
qq_41562566
·
2024-01-22 10:46
Spring
Boot
spring
cloud
负载均衡
spring
HTTP客户端
Feign
0、RestTemplate方式调用存在的问题之前
远程调用
的代码publicOrderqueryOrderById(LongorderId){//1.查询订单从数据库中获取Orderorder=orderMapper.findById
我爱布朗熊
·
2024-01-22 07:41
springcloud
http
java
spring
SpringCloud之Open
Feign
的学习、快速上手
1、什么是Open
Feign
Open
Feign
简化了Http的开发。
两年半的个人练习生^_^
·
2024-01-22 06:18
spring
cloud
学习
spring
SpringCloud--
Feign
&Gateway
SpringCloud–
Feign
&Gatewayhttp客户端-
Feign
RestTemplate方式调用存在的问题:代码可读性差,编程体验不统一参数复杂url难以维护而http客户端
Feign
可以帮助我们优雅的实现
Java之弟
·
2024-01-22 05:57
SpringCloud
spring
cloud
SpringCloud&Eureka学习教程
集成了各种微服务功能组件,并基于Springboot实现了这些组件的自动装配,从而提供了良好的开箱即用体验官网地址:https://spring.io/projects/spring-cloud服务拆分&
远程调用
服务拆分注意事项
Java之弟
·
2024-01-22 05:56
SpringCloud
spring
cloud
eureka
学习
微服务:Open
Feign
进行服务通讯时携带Token数据
文章目录一、Open
Feign
是什么?
Feign
是SpringCloud提供的一个声明式的伪Http客户端,它使得调用远程服务就像调用本地服务一样简单,只需要创建一个接口并添加一个注解即可。
多云&秋雨
·
2024-01-21 13:31
spring
cloud
微服务
spring
分布式
【实战】SpringBoot自定义 starter及使用
SpringBootstarter简介starter的开发步骤实战演示自定义starter的使用写在最后前言各位大佬在使用springboot或者springcloud的时候都会根据需求引入各种starter,比如gateway、
feign
小沈同学呀
·
2024-01-21 12:08
Spring
开发工具
个人日记
spring
boot
java
后端
starter
spring
RPC教程 2.支持并发与异步的客户端
varreplystring//string有默认值err=client.Call("HelloService.Hello","hi",&reply)//即是一次请求}对net/rpc而言,一个函数需要能够被
远程调用
确实可以
·
2024-01-21 06:53
#
Go实现rpc
rpc
网络
golang
Nacos配置管理、Fegin
远程调用
、Gateway服务网关
1.Nacos配置管理Nacos除了可以做注册中心,同样可以做配置管理来使用。1.1.统一配置管理当微服务部署的实例越来越多,达到数十、数百时,逐个修改微服务配置就会让人抓狂,而且很容易出错。我们需要一种统一配置管理方案,可以集中管理所有实例的配置。Nacos一方面可以将配置集中管理,另一方可以在配置变更时,及时通知微服务,实现配置的热更新。1.1.1.在nacos中添加配置文件注意:项目的核心配
老黄爱编码
·
2024-01-21 04:24
SpringCloud
gateway
微服务
spring
cloud
结算功能和鉴权传递
1.1用户点击结算按钮(同步渲染)1.2请求订单服务1.3订单服务通过
feign
请求选中购物车接口,将结果封装成orderitem(订单详情)1.4订单详情返回结算界面1.5结算页面axios异步请求用户地址接口
一路向北看星晴
·
2024-01-21 00:40
java
SpringCloud和SBA
A网关gateway,分布式系统的统一入口(路由分配请求)B配置中心nacos,提供远程配置文件C注册中心nacos,注册记录微服务ip和端口信息,统一管理和调用Dloadbalencer,open
Feign
一路向北看星晴
·
2024-01-21 00:10
spring
cloud
gateway
spring
分布式定时任务系列8:XXL-job源码分析之
远程调用
传送门分布式定时任务系列1:XXL-job安装分布式定时任务系列2:XXL-job使用分布式定时任务系列3:任务执行引擎设计分布式定时任务系列4:任务执行引擎设计续分布式定时任务系列5:XXL-job中blockingQueue的应用分布式定时任务系列6:XXL-job触发日志过大引发的CPU告警分布式定时任务系列7:XXL-job源码分析之任务触发Java并发编程实战1:java中的阻塞队列通讯
kobe_t
·
2024-01-20 20:36
#
分布式调度
xxl-job
【SpringCloud】12、Spring Cloud使用Open
Feign
实现服务调用
1、
Feign
Feign
是SpringCloudNetflix组件中的一量级Restful的HTTP服务客户端,实现了负载均衡和Rest调用的开源框架,封装了Ribbon和RestTemplate,实现了
Asurplus
·
2024-01-20 20:38
SpringCloud系列
springcloud
openFeign
服务调用
feign
Zookeeper依赖关系
作为依赖关系,您可以了解Zookeeper中注册的其他应用程序,您可以通过
Feign
(REST客户端构建器)以及SpringRestTemplate呼叫。
咔啡
·
2024-01-20 14:11
java spring cloud版b2b2c社交电商spring cloud分布式微服务-docker-
feign
-hystrix(六)
上一节我们讨论
feign
的配置,这节我们讨论一下,
feign
+hystrix调用生产者时,进行容错处理。
ITsupuerlady
·
2024-01-20 13:10
RPC和Http的区别
RPCRPC(RemoteProcedureCall,远程过程调用)是一种计算机通信协议,它允许程序调用另一个地址空间(通常是另一台机器上)的过程或函数,而不需要显式编码这个
远程调用
的细节。
mhz2977170
·
2024-01-20 11:22
rpc
http
网络协议
Spring Cloud详细入门使用
SpringCloud服务注册与发现EurekaServer启动服务注册服务发现NacosServer启动(nacos2.2.0)服务注册服务发现服务集群命名空间配置中心集群搭建负载均衡RPC远程过程调用
Feign
怡人蝶梦
·
2024-01-20 08:59
JAVA
spring
cloud
spring
后端
事件驱动架构
rpc通信,
远程调用
。生产者和消费者要有相同的stub存根。消费者和生产者的调用接口是耦合的。事件驱动核心:上下游不进行通信中间通过MQ消息中间件,broker代理。
可爱的小小小狼
·
2024-01-20 07:28
架构
架构
微服务-服务拆分和
远程调用
任何分布式架构都离不开服务的拆分,微服务也是一样。一、服务拆分原则微服务拆分时的几个原则:不同微服务,不要重复开发相同业务微服务数据独立,不要访问其它微服务的数据库微服务可以将自己的业务暴露为接口,供其它微服务调用二、服务拆分示例以微服务cloud-demo为例,其结构如下:cloud-demo:父工程,管理依赖order-service:订单微服务,负责订单相关业务user-service:用户
Maiko Star
·
2024-01-20 06:13
Spring
Cloud
微服务
后端怎样防止重复提交订单?
参考文章通常我们可以在前端通过防抖和节流来解决短时间内请求重复提交的问题,如果因网络问题、Nginx重试机制、微服务
Feign
重试机制或者用户故意绕过前端防抖和节流设置,直接频繁发起请求,都会导致系统防重请求失败
greedy-hat
·
2024-01-20 04:15
实习
java
Dubbo 概述
自动发现(3)Dubbo可以用于1.透明化的远程方法调用2.软负载均衡及容错机制3.服务自动注册与发现(4)Dubbo的框架设计:1.服务接口层2.配置层3.服务代理层4.服务注册层5.集群层6.监控层7.
远程调用
层
watermountain
·
2024-01-19 19:52
Open
Feign
的使用
目录使用测试准备依赖包Enable
Feign
Clients注解@
Feign
Client定义fallback定义fallbackFactory测试超时时间配置使用测试准备在商品服务中声明一个测试方法,其它代
卡_卡_西
·
2024-01-19 17:03
Spring
Cloud
Alibaba
springcloud
spring
cloud
RabbitMQ
传统方式,系统之间直接调用(http协议httpclient/open
Feign
)中间件2MQ的优势异步、解耦、削峰1应用解耦系统的耦合性越高,容错性就越低,可维护性就越
夨落旳尐孩649
·
2024-01-19 17:30
rabbitmq
分布式
详解SpringCloud微服务技术栈:Gateway网关(断言、过滤器、跨域问题)
作者简介:一位大四、研0学生,正在努力准备大四暑假的实习上期文章:详解SpringCloud微服务技术栈:
Feign
远程调用
、最佳实践、错误排查订阅专栏:微服务技术全家桶希望文章对你们有所帮助现在集群中会有很多的微服务
布布要成为最负责的男人
·
2024-01-19 12:50
微服务技术全家桶
spring
cloud
微服务
gateway
spring
断言
过滤器
跨域
详解SpringCloud微服务技术栈:
Feign
远程调用
、最佳实践、错误排查
一位大四、研0学生,正在努力准备大四暑假的实习上期文章:详解SpringCloud微服务技术栈:Nacos配置管理订阅专栏:微服务技术全家桶希望文章对你们有所帮助之前使用RestTemplate来实现
远程调用
布布要成为最负责的男人
·
2024-01-19 12:49
微服务技术全家桶
spring
cloud
微服务
spring
java
后端
Feign
open
feign
远程调用
实现
@OverridepublicvoidaddInterceptors(InterceptorRegistryregistry){String[]patterns=newString[]{"/login","/order/getMiaoShaResult","/verifyCode/get"};registry.addInterceptor(sysInterceptor()).addPathPatt
九品印相
·
2024-01-19 11:15
java
spring
boot
开发语言
Dubbo 3.x源码(1)—RPC是什么?RPC与HTTP的关系
两个不同服务器上的服务之间如果想要进行数据传输或者方法调用,那么需要通过网络编程来实现,如果我们手动实现网络编程进行
远程调用
的话,会带来巨大的工作量,并且还需要考虑底层所使用的网络协议,序列化方式等等。
刘Java
·
2024-01-19 10:56
Dubbo
3.x
源码
rpc
http
网络
dubbo
Dubbo RPC协议底层原理与实现
Dubbo作为一个分布式服务框架,使用了自定义的DubboRPC(RemoteProcedureCall)协议来实现
远程调用
。
亿星海
·
2024-01-19 10:22
dubbo
rpc
网络协议
微服务网关的鉴权功能
1网关如何整合open
Feign
完成统一鉴权A引入open
Feign
的依赖B注入user服务,@lazy注解解决循环依赖Copen
Feign
阻塞线程,网关非阻塞线程,所以改成非阻塞调用D加载优先级,提高全局过滤器优先级
一路向北看星晴
·
2024-01-19 09:38
java
2024-01-18(SpringCloud)
1.微服务项目开发:Nacos注册中心,open
Feign
远程调用
,loadBalance负载均衡,网关。这几个组件是微服务中最常见也是必须要解决的问题的组件,掌握这几个就具备微服务项目的能力了。
陈xr
·
2024-01-19 07:34
随记日志
spring
cloud
java
springcloud Open
Feign
服务接口调用
文章目录代码下载地址Open
Feign
简介Open
Feign
使用步骤测试Open
Feign
超时控制超时设置,故意设置超时演示出错情况服务提供方8001故意写暂停程序服务消费方80添加超时方法Payment
Feign
Service
我是小水水啊
·
2024-01-19 07:55
springcloud
spring
cloud
spring
后端
Spring cloud - 跨服务上传文件
那么在各业务需要调用文件上传下载时,就需要通过
feign
跨服务调用。
御坂10027
·
2024-01-19 07:08
工作日常
spring
spring
cloud
java
spring
上一页
2
3
4
5
6
7
8
9
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他